Ordinals
beta
Sat 1914122311898068
decimal
752595.436898068
degree
0°122595′627″436898068‴
percentile
91.1486816192192%
name
ahfbqwunxld
cycle
0
epoch
3
period
373
block
752595
offset
436898068
timestamp
2022-09-04 15:16:22 UTC
rarity
common
prev
next